I have been running Apache successfully on an XP home machine for quite awhile. Then two weeks ago when I installed the latest batch of XP updates (not SP2, I've had that for awhile) and the latest Zone Alarm update, I started having problems with Apache. It will work great for exactly 11 to 12 hours then just stop responding. To get it working again I have to stop then start the service, simply restarting the service doesn't seem to work.
At first I thought it was Zone Alarm because I updated that at the same time, but I have tried going back to the old version and had the same problem. Also, when Apache stops responding I can't get it to respond at the external or internal IP address as well as at localhost. I don't seem to have a problem with any other internet application or server.
I have looked through all the system and Apache logs I could find and didn't see anything that correlates to the time when Apache stops responding.
